Cerebral palsy is a disorder of coordination and movement that can result in a wide range of disabilities, including developmental delays, skeletal disorders and limb disorders such as spasticity (extremely tight or stiff muscles) or dyskinesia (rapid jerking movements) and ataxia (balance and motor control issues). Symptoms of CP vary depending on the type of brain injury that triggers it, and can range from mild to severe.

CP is caused by injury to the central nervous system and the brain that can happen prior to birth, during labor and delivery or after a trauma or accident at any time. The neurodevelopmental disorder can affect motor control and movement as well as speech, vision and more. Certain children suffering from CP are able to live full lives, while others require extensive assistance and 24-hour care.

Medical professionals have an obligation to observe a high standard of care when providing treatment to patients. If they fail to comply with this requirement and patients suffer an injury that causes CP, the medical professional could be held responsible for medical negligence.

Families must be able to prove, in order to prevail in a CP case, that the medical professional breached their professional standards and aggravated a child's injury. They must also prove that the injury resulted in the amount of damages that can be quantifiable, including suffering and pain and loss of income, medical expenses, special education needs, and other economic harm.
